Subject: User module cut-over complete

Team — the Lornath user module is now served by the standalone Idencore service as of 03:00. Monolith endpoints return 301s; sessions migrated cleanly, no forced logouts observed. Expect stray cache-related login hiccups for ~1 hour. Escalate anything beyond that to the platform channel. The service runs with the following configuration.

service settings:
PRAIX_LOG_LEVEL=error
PRAIX_METRICS_HOST=metrics.praix.qorvelcorp.corp
PRAIX_POOL_SIZE=16

## Approvals — Stockmend Reconciliation Job

Manual runs of the inventory reconciliation job require approval. No exceptions during business hours. Off-hours, on-call may trigger a dry run only; a full write run still needs sign-off after the fact. Failed runs auto-page. Do not rerun more than twice without review of the delta report. Approval authority rests with the person named below.

named custodian: Oliath Ralax

The Cartwheel pick-list optimizer exposes a single `POST /optimize` endpoint that accepts a pick manifest and returns a route-ordered list minimizing aisle crossings. Responses are deterministic for identical inputs, which simplifies review diffs. All requests must be authenticated; unauthenticated calls return 401. For verifying behavior against the Dunmore staging warehouse, use the credential below.

session JWT of yawep-yawep = eyJhbGciOiJIUzI1NiIsInR5cCI6IkpXVCJ9.eyJzdWIiOiI3pWF3_In0.aXYsHiog